Lighting can completely change your home’s appearance and take it to the next level. You want to know the most optimal lighting themes for your home. Below, we will go over some of the biggest trends in home lighting.
Decorative Lighting
Recessed Lighting – Recessed lighting is installed in the ceiling, and can act as a spotlight for everything it hangs over. If you wa nt a modern, refreshing look, install recessed lighting in the corners of a room.
Track Lighting – To highlight some of the key elements in an area, install track lighting. For example, track lighting over a beautiful piece of art will create a localized point in the room.
Hanging Lanterns – For a whimsical light fixture, you definitely want a hanging lantern. To create an ambient, calming feel, install hanging lanterns onto your patio.
Utility Lighting
Ceiling-Mounted Lighting – Ceiling-mounted lighting is perfect for lighting large areas with just one fixture. You want one that is easy to blend into the design of the room.
Flood Lights – Flood lights are high-intensity lights, usually used outdoors. They can brighten up your yard, and you could even use a motion sensor.
Green Lighting
LED Lighting – One of the biggest trends in light bulb technology is the LED light. LED, short for light emitting diode, emit less heat than a regular bulb. They’re also more durable and can cost less on your energy bill.
Compact Fluorescent Lighting – These lights are also known as CFLs. CFLs are designed to fit most home fixtures, and they can save you money as they require less energy and last longer than regular light bulbs.
